How exposed is Oxford to wildfire?

Moderate
37thpercentile nationally

Oxford sits at the 37th percentile nationally for wildfire risk to structures — close to the middle of USFS's national wildfire-risk range — per USFS's Wildfire Risk to Communities model, built from its 541 counted buildings, not vegetation cover alone. (Source: USFS's Wildfire Risk to Communities methodology.)

Separately from the risk score above, Oxford's burn probability — fire likelihood with no building count factored in — sits at the 36th percentile nationally.

Where Oxford's buildings actually sit

541Total buildings
81.3%Direct exposure
18.7%Indirect exposure
0%Minimal exposure

USFS classifies 81.3% of Oxford's buildings as Direct exposure, higher than its 18.7% Indirect share and far above its 0% Minimal share — a profile where 440 structures sit close enough to vegetation that lot clearing matters most.

Where Oxford ranks

Oxford scores 37th nationally and 37th within New Jersey — close enough that its state context doesn't change the picture the national number already gives. Among the 31,521 US communities USFS scores, Oxford ranks 19,855 for wildfire risk (1 is highest) and 16,701 by building count (1 is largest).
